AAA Cuts the Ribbon on New Devon Store

Grand opening kicks off a week of freebies and promotions to draw attention to a new kind of car shop.

officially cut the ribbon on its new car care and AAA services center at 849 W. Lancaster Ave in Wayne Monday morning. Tredyffrin Board of Supervisors Chairwoman Michelle Kichline was among a host of local dignitaries on hand for the official grand opening and ribbon cutting ceremony.

The facility actually opened back in December but waited until now to hold the official grand opening. 

The location, next to Whole Foods in Devon, is set back from Lancaster Ave., and backs up to the SEPTA and Amtrack rail lines.  It can be a little hard to see from Lancaster Ave. if you're not looking for it.

"I'm most excited about how the space has been re-used," Kichline told Patch. "We are the first community in Pennsylvania to get one (of the new AAA facilities)." AAA-Mid-Atlantic is opening a similar facility on Baltimore Pike in Clifton Heights, Delaware County.

As part of the festivites the store, which features a not-for-profit full service auto repair shop, is giving away some big prizes and services.
